Benjamin Stölzner is a scholar working on Astronomy and Astrophysics, Ecology and Instrumentation. According to data from OpenAlex, Benjamin Stölzner has authored 3 papers receiving a total of 73 indexed citations (citations by other indexed papers that have themselves been cited), including 3 papers in Astronomy and Astrophysics, 1 paper in Ecology and 1 paper in Instrumentation. Recurrent topics in Benjamin Stölzner's work include Galaxies: Formation, Evolution, Phenomena (3 papers), Cosmology and Gravitation Theories (2 papers) and Stellar, planetary, and galactic studies (1 paper). Benjamin Stölzner is often cited by papers focused on Galaxies: Formation, Evolution, Phenomena (3 papers), Cosmology and Gravitation Theories (2 papers) and Stellar, planetary, and galactic studies (1 paper). Benjamin Stölzner collaborates with scholars based in Germany, Netherlands and United Kingdom. Benjamin Stölzner's co-authors include Maciej Bilicki, Julien Lesgourgues, A. Cuoco, Benjamin Joachimi, Tilman Tröster, Jan Luca van den Busch, Konrad Kuijken, Angus H. Wright, Benjamin Giblin and Marika Asgari and has published in prestigious journals such as Monthly Notices of the Royal Astronomical Society, Astronomy and Astrophysics and Physical review. D.

All Works

3 of 3 papers shown
1.
Stölzner, Benjamin, Benjamin Joachimi, & A. Korn. (2022). Optimizing the shape of photometric redshift distributions with clustering cross-correlations. Monthly Notices of the Royal Astronomical Society. 519(2). 2438–2450. 4 indexed citations
2.
Stölzner, Benjamin, Benjamin Joachimi, Marika Asgari, et al.. (2021). Geometry versus growth. Astronomy and Astrophysics. 655. A11–A11. 12 indexed citations
3.
Stölzner, Benjamin, A. Cuoco, Julien Lesgourgues, & Maciej Bilicki. (2018). Updated tomographic analysis of the integrated Sachs-Wolfe effect and implications for dark energy. Physical review. D. 97(6). 57 indexed citations
